Getting around Nyborg and exploring the region
Nyborg is well-connected by rail, road, and sea, which makes it convenient for business travelers who need flexibility. Nyborg Station offers trains to major Danish cities, and you’ll find bus options that connect to surrounding towns. The proximity to the Great Belt Bridge means easy trips to Zealand or Funen’s wider attractions, making day trips practical without a long commute. If you’re leasing a car for the stay, you’ll enjoy comfortable drives through scenic coastal routes and green landscapes that Denmark is known for. For biking enthusiasts, Nyborg’s flat terrain and scenic routes provide a healthy way to explore in the morning or after meetings, with plenty of bike-friendly paths near the harbor and along the shoreline.
Activities and local experiences: culture, nature, and relaxation
Even during business trips, Nyborg offers a spectrum of activities to balance work and leisure. The town itself has a rich history, visible in its preserved streets and architectural landmarks. Nyborg Castle, a historic fortress with centuries of stories, makes for an insightful half-day excursion. If you enjoy architecture and history, a stroll through the town’s medieval core and along the harbor promenade gives you a feel for Danish town life and the mix of old and new that characterizes the area. For nature lovers, nearby beaches such as Nyborg Strand provide refreshing sea air and scenic sunset walks. The area also offers cycling routes and walking trails that let you unwind after a busy day of meetings.
For a broader cultural experience, consider a day trip to Egeskov Castle, one of Denmark’s finest Renaissance castles with its impressive grounds and gardens. Its proximity to Funen’s southern landscapes makes it a rewarding excursion when you have a free afternoon. Booking tips for vacation rentals and holiday rentals in Nyborg
To maximize your stay, consider the following practical tips when choosing a Nyborg rental:
- Look for a dedicated workspace with a desk, a comfortable chair, adequate lighting, and power outlets within reach of your laptop and monitor setup.
- Confirm wifi speed and reliability in the listing. If possible, request a speed test result or a note about uptime and router location.
- Check for noise levels during your typical work hours. A quieter room, away from common living areas, can significantly improve concentration during calls.
- Inspect the kitchen and laundry facilities if you’re staying for an extended period. A well-equipped kitchen reduces the need to eat out for every meal, saving time and improving work-life balance.
- Ask about flexible check-in and check-out options, especially if you have varying meeting schedules across time zones.
- Read guest reviews carefully for mentions of wifi reliability, workspace ergonomics, and responsiveness of hosts to issues.
- Consider proximity to a grocery store, pharmacy, and café clusters to minimize daily errands and keep your focus on work tasks.
